Bangkok (VNA) - Thailand is on course to surpass its target of attracting 10 million foreign visitors this year, according to government spokesman Anucha Burapachaisri.
Addressing a conferenceon November 5, Anucha said that tourist arrivals to Thailand totalled 7.56million as of October 30, with at least 3 million visitors expected during theremaining months of 2022. 

More than 1 millionMalaysians have toured Thailand this year, making them the single-largest groupof travellers.

Almost 600,000Indians visited Thailand in the first nine months of 2022, compared with lessthan 1,000 a year earlier.

The Thai Cabinet inJuly lifted all travel restrictions after a significant decrease in the numberof COVID-19 cases in a bid to spur its economy and draw tourists.

The number ofvisitors may surge to 18 million next year and generate about 970 billion baht(26 billion USD) in tourism revenue, Anucha also said./.
